详细设计第8组语文百题测练系统详细设计

详细设计第8组语文百题测练系统详细设计

ID:42220034

大小:580.13 KB

页数:13页

时间:2019-09-09

详细设计第8组语文百题测练系统详细设计_第1页
详细设计第8组语文百题测练系统详细设计_第2页
详细设计第8组语文百题测练系统详细设计_第3页
详细设计第8组语文百题测练系统详细设计_第4页
详细设计第8组语文百题测练系统详细设计_第5页
资源描述:

《详细设计第8组语文百题测练系统详细设计》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库

1、东莞理工学院城市学院题目:语文百题测练系统详细设计报告专业:软件工程(本)年级:2012级3班小组成员:王振鸿、郑冬坊、卢耀荣指导教师:白晨明老师时间:2014.9.7—2015」」5地点:3B312东莞理工学院城市学院计算机与信息科学系制2014年9月目录1引言31」编写目的31.2背景31.3定义31.4参考资料32程序系统的结构42」程序结构图42.2程序文件清单53程序设计说明63.1程序描述63.2功自芒63.3性能73.4输人项73.5输出项83.6算法83.7流程逻辑83.8接口123.9存储分配133.1

2、0限制条件133.11测试计划133.12尚未解决的问题13详细设计说明书1引言1-1编写目的编写目的:详细说明语文百题测练系统各个层次中的每一个程序(模块)的设计考虑。阅读对象:本说明书的预期读者为用户或需求分析人员、测试人员、项目管理人员。1.2背景1.开发软件名称:语文百题测练系统2.项目与其他软件的关系:a)运行平台:本项目采用WINDOWS为操作系统b)开发软件:采用HTML,JSP作为开发软件c)数据库:采用SQL2005/2008为开发软件的后台数据库1.3定义语文百题测练系统(ChineseExercis

3、ePracticeSystem),CEPS是一款而向中学生方便练习的系统。该系统解决方案重点解决对习题资源的导入、管理、分析、筛选以及相应的互动。系统的编辑人员、发布人员使用该系统来提交、审批、发布习题。1.4参考资料《软件工程基础与实例分析》《详细设计说明书(GB8567——88)》2程序系统的结构2.1程序结构图系统的总体结构图如下图所示。百题测练系统用户管理试题管理做题管理信息管理成绩反馈集体通讯个体通讯练习试卷考试删除试题整理试题上传试题用户信息修改▼用户注册0自定义组合试卷提高训练错题训练好题训练▼知识体检2.

4、2程序文件清单子模块名程序文件名编写语言简要描述用户注册登录user.jspJSP用户注册登录之后才可以进行其他一些模块的操作用户信息修改U_update.jspJSP正确登录后用户可以进行修改试题上传STshangchuan・jspJSP老师将试题划分归类、并上传试题整理STzhengli.jspJSP学生将错题和好题整理分类进行收集,便于继续练习;试卷考试STexam.jspJSP学生根据试卷进行测试,老师对学生做好的试卷进行评改知识体检zhishitijian.jspJSP根据学生所学的基础知识进行基础测验错题训练

5、cuotixunlian.jspJSP学生对整理后的错题进行再次测练,巩固好题训练haotixunlian.jspJSP学生对整理后的好题进行再次测练,巩固提高训练tigaoxunlian・jspJSP根据知识的难度逐渐增大对学生所学知识进行提高测验自定义组合试卷suijishijuan.jspJSP随机组合试卷对学生所学知识进行测验个体通讯getitongxurujspJSP用户对某个指定对象进行通讯集体通讯jititongxun.jspJSP老师对全部对象进行通讯成绩反馈chengjifankui・jspJSP给学生

6、统计错题知识点,显示薄弱部分3程序设计说明3.1程序描述本项目语文百题测练系统旨在帮助学生对试题的整理、练习与收藏,便于学生学习,解决学生对于纸质试卷因放置杂乱无章而无法好好练习、复习的烦恼。本项目语文百题测练系统的特点:易操作、系统界面简洁大方舒服、为学生及老师服务。3.2功能语文百题测练系统主要有四大模块:1.用户管理模块主要完成用户的注册、用户信息的修改功能。2.试题管理模块教师功能,系统所有的试题都由该功能上传,上传时要选择试题类型再分类存入数据库,同时可以进行删除功能。学生功能,做错的题通过整理可选录入错题集川

7、,便于以后再次练习。3.做题管理模块教师功能,实现批改学生上传的试卷的功能,教师还可对试卷写批注。学生功能,进行知识测试,并可以针对一个知识点进行的专项训练、一个章节知识点的基础训练以及错题的再练,从而不断提高学习水平。4.信息管理模块教师功能,教师可向全体或个体学生发送学习任务,并可以对学生提供帮助。3.3性能3.3.1精度a.输入数据库的信息要求保证实时性、正确性和全面性。b.输出的信息要保证正确无误。3.3.2时间特性要求1、响应时间应在人的感觉和视觉事件范I韦I内。2、更新处理时间,随着百题测练系统的版本升级,该

8、系统将相应进行更新。3.3.3灵活性操作方式的变化:本产品的表现层基于W3C的HTML及Javascript,兼容于主流的浏览器及操作系统。运行环境的变化:适用于Windows操作系统。3.3.3输入输出要求本产品屮数据库存储采用SQLServer2005/2008数据库软件,数据表采用UTF・8编码存储。3.4输人

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。